Adapted Soccer Video Game Helps "Empower" Individuals with CP From: Rehab Management - 09/03/2014 A student in the University of Alicante's Multimedia Engineering department recently engineered a soccer game adapted to accommodate individuals with cerebral palsy (CP), allowing for operation with a foot switch, a push rod head switch, and a hand switch. The game’s features are intended to provide the group with the same opportunities, regardless of physical condition, requiring only access to any type of switch such as foot, joystick, or rod.
